Index: content/public/browser/android/external_video_surface_container.h |
diff --git a/content/public/browser/android/external_video_surface_container.h b/content/public/browser/android/external_video_surface_container.h |
index 38cbe5987bac76912dcae34ef3502e4e4ffe0f9a..f792dd3bb99eb8bc41bcf20e12b562b0a1a9777c 100644 |
--- a/content/public/browser/android/external_video_surface_container.h |
+++ b/content/public/browser/android/external_video_surface_container.h |
@@ -32,7 +32,11 @@ class CONTENT_EXPORT ExternalVideoSurfaceContainer { |
const SurfaceCreatedCB& surface_created_cb, |
const SurfaceDestroyedCB& surface_destroyed_cb) = 0; |
- // Called when a media player wants to release an external video surface. |
+ // Returns id of player currently using the external video surface. |
+ virtual int GetCurrentPlayerId() = 0; |
boliu
2014/12/08 17:51:47
How about define INVALID_PLAYER_ID in this class.
Hugo Holgersson
2014/12/09 15:35:28
Done.
|
+ |
+ // Called when a media player wants to release a certain player's external |
+ // video surface. |
virtual void ReleaseExternalVideoSurface(int player_id) = 0; |
// Called when the position and size of the video element which uses |